Work assignment - 英语词汇详解

Meaning 1:assigned task (Work assignment)

Work assignment 🔊
/wɜːrk əˈsaɪnmənt/
n.
A specific task or piece of work that is given to someone to do, often by a boss or teacher.

📁 Category:Behaviors & Actions 🔖 Level:Intermediate

📘 Details & Usage

📖 Root Explanation
Work (from Old English weorc) + assignment (Latin assignare: ad- 'to' + signare 'to mark').
💡 Mnemonic
Imagine your boss writing your name on a task list: that is your work assignment.
📖 Example
My manager gave me a new work assignment this Monday, and I need to finish it by Friday. 🔊 My manager gave me a new work assignment this Monday, and I need to finish it by Friday.
🔗 Collocations
complete a work assignment – to finish a given task
hand in a work assignment – to submit a completed task
a difficult work assignment – a challenging task that requires effort
🔄 Synonyms
task (n.) – A piece of work to be done or undertaken.
duty (n.) – A task or action that one is required to perform as part of a job or role.
🚫 Antonyms
leisure (n.) – Free time when one is not working or doing duties.
🌱 Derivatives
assign (v.) – To allocate or designate a task to someone.
assignee (n.) – A person who receives an assignment.
📖 Cultural Story
The term 'work assignment' emerged in the 19th century with industrialization, where tasks were formally delegated. Today it's standard in project management and academic settings.
